This is a U8500-based phone named Samsung Galaxy Exhibit or
Samsung SGH-T599, codenamed "Codina TMO" as it was made
for T-Mobile.

In order to add meta-schema checks for additional/unevaluatedProperties
being present, all schema need to make this explicit. As the top-level
board/SoC schemas always have additional properties, add
'additionalProperties: true'.
